What Is a Harley Sissy Bar and Why Is It Essential for Carrying Luggage?
A Harley sissy bar is a vertical support attached to the rear of a Harley-Davidson motorcycle, designed to provide passenger back support and serve as a luggage carrier. It often features a padded backrest for comfort and additional mounting points for securing luggage or accessories.
The Motorcycle Safety Foundation describes the sissy bar as an essential safety and comfort feature for both the rider and passenger, enhancing the overall riding experience.
Sissy bars come in various styles and heights, catering to specific rider preferences and luggage needs. They can be customized with additional accessories like luggage racks, which improve their functionality. Many riders use sissy bars to securely transport items during long trips or everyday use.

Which Materials Ensure Durability in Harley Sissy Bar Luggage?
Durability in Harley Sissy Bar luggage is ensured by using robust materials that can withstand weather and wear.
- Nylon
- Polyester
- Leather
- Water-Resistant Coating
- Reinforced Stitching
Nylon:
Nylon is a popular choice for Harley Sissy Bar luggage due to its strength and lightweight properties. It offers excellent resistance to abrasions and tears. Many nylon bags also contain additional reinforcement, enhancing their overall durability. For example, heavy-duty nylon can withstand harsh weather and prolonged exposure to sunlight without fading or degrading.
Polyester:
Polyester is another widely used material known for its robustness and resistance to shrinking and stretching. It is often treated with a water-resistant coating to enhance its protective features. This feature allows polyester luggage to resist moisture and dirt, making it an efficient choice for bikers facing variable weather conditions.
Leather:
Leather provides a classic look and exceptional durability. High-quality leather, when properly maintained, becomes more robust over time and develops a unique patina. It is less prone to wear and tear compared to synthetic fabrics, but it requires regular conditioning to maintain its properties. Many motorcycle enthusiasts prefer leather for its aesthetic and vintage appeal, even though it can be heavier and pricier.
Water-Resistant Coating:
Water-resistant coatings, often applied to synthetic materials, help protect luggage from rain and splashing. These coatings create a barrier that prevents water from seeping through. They are an essential feature for anyone riding in inclement weather. Some manufacturers provide data on the effectiveness of their coatings, giving consumers peace of mind about the protection offered.
Reinforced Stitching:
Reinforced stitching enhances the durability of luggage and prevents seams from coming apart over time. Many bags employ double stitching in high-stress areas, ensuring that they can handle heavy loads without compromising integrity. This feature is particularly important for motorcycle luggage, which must endure vibrations and movement while riding.
